Zooxanthellae
Part of speech: noun
Definitions
- A type of symbiotic algae that lives within the tissues of coral and other marine organisms, providing them with energy through photosynthesis
- These microscopic organisms help maintain the health of coral reefs by supplying nutrients and oxygen while benefiting from the protection of their host

Etymology: The term "zooxanthellae" has its roots in the Greek language, combining "zoo," meaning "animal," and "xanthos," meaning "yellow." This fascinating word was coined in the late 19th century to describe the symbiotic algae that live within the tissues of certain marine animals, particularly corals. These tiny organisms play a crucial role in the health of coral reefs, providing energy through photosynthesis, which in turn sustains the larger animal host. The relationship between zooxanthellae and corals is a perfect example of mutualism in nature, where both parties benefit from the association. The first recorded use of the term in English can be traced back to around 1885, emerging from the scientific discourse surrounding marine biology and ecology. As researchers began to understand the vital role that these algae play in the ecosystem, the need for a specific term to describe them became apparent. By naming them "zooxanthellae," scientists highlighted not only their connection to the animal kingdom but also their distinctive pigmentation, which is often yellow or brown, lending a vibrant hue to coral reefs. Over time, the meaning of "zooxanthellae" has evolved to encompass not just the algae themselves but also the broader implications of their role in marine ecosystems. The health of coral reefs, which are among the most diverse and productive ecosystems on the planet, is intricately linked to the presence of these algae. When environmental stressors, such as rising ocean temperatures or pollution, disturb this delicate balance, it can lead to phenomena like coral bleaching, where corals expel their zooxanthellae and risk starvation, ultimately jeopardizing the entire reef system.
